epidemiological data

Epidemiological data involves collecting and analyzing information about how diseases spread, who they affect, and their impact on populations. It helps identify patterns, risk factors, and trends over time, guiding public health decisions. For example, data might show who is most at risk for a disease, how many people are affected, and where outbreaks are happening. This information allows health authorities to develop strategies to prevent and control illnesses, ultimately protecting community health.
